虚拟机如何用安卓模拟器

虚拟机如何用安卓模拟器

虚拟机使用安卓模拟器的方法有:安装安卓模拟器软件、配置虚拟机环境、优化性能、解决兼容性问题。 其中,安装安卓模拟器软件是关键步骤,选择合适的安卓模拟器软件,能确保虚拟机上的安卓系统运行流畅。一般推荐使用主流的安卓模拟器软件如BlueStacks、NoxPlayer或Genymotion,这些模拟器具有广泛的兼容性和丰富的功能,能满足大部分用户的需求。

一、安装安卓模拟器软件

1、选择合适的安卓模拟器

市面上有多种安卓模拟器可供选择,包括BlueStacks、NoxPlayer、Genymotion等。每款模拟器都有其独特的功能和优势。BlueStacks因其较高的兼容性和性能表现,适用于大多数应用和游戏,特别是那些对图形处理有较高要求的应用。NoxPlayer则以其简洁的界面和易于使用的特点受欢迎,适合初学者使用。Genymotion主要面向开发者,提供了丰富的开发工具和调试功能。

2、下载和安装模拟器

在确定了适合的模拟器后,前往其官方网站下载相应的安装包。以BlueStacks为例,下载完成后,双击安装文件,按照提示进行安装。安装过程可能需要几分钟,安装完成后,启动模拟器,进行初始设置。

二、配置虚拟机环境

1、创建虚拟机

首先,你需要在虚拟机管理软件(如VMware、VirtualBox)中创建一个新的虚拟机。选择操作系统类型为“其他”或“未知”,版本选择“其他”。为虚拟机分配足够的系统资源,如CPU、内存和硬盘空间,以保证安卓模拟器的流畅运行。一般来说,分配至少2个CPU核心和4GB内存是较为理想的配置。

2、安装操作系统

为虚拟机安装一个基本的操作系统,这里推荐使用Windows操作系统,因为大多数安卓模拟器都支持Windows环境。安装操作系统的过程与在物理机上安装类似,按照提示完成操作系统的安装后,进入系统进行基本配置,如安装必要的驱动程序和软件更新。

三、优化性能

1、启用硬件加速

硬件加速能够显著提升安卓模拟器的性能。确保虚拟机管理软件中启用了硬件虚拟化支持(如Intel VT-x或AMD-V)。在模拟器的设置中,启用硬件加速选项。以BlueStacks为例,进入设置菜单,找到“引擎”选项卡,选择“使用硬件加速模式”。

2、调整模拟器配置

根据虚拟机的硬件配置,调整模拟器的设置,以获得最佳性能。一般来说,可以适当增加模拟器的CPU核心数和内存分配。也可以调整图形设置,如分辨率和帧率,以平衡性能和视觉效果。

四、解决兼容性问题

1、安装必要的依赖软件

有些安卓模拟器可能需要额外的依赖软件才能正常运行。在安装模拟器之前,确保虚拟机中已经安装了这些依赖软件,如Microsoft Visual C++ Redistributable、DirectX等。可以在模拟器的官方网站上找到相关的安装说明和下载链接。

2、更新驱动程序和软件

确保虚拟机中所有的驱动程序和软件都是最新版本。特别是图形驱动程序和虚拟机管理软件的版本更新,可能会解决一些兼容性问题。定期检查并安装系统更新,以获得最新的功能和安全补丁。

五、使用安卓模拟器

1、配置和启动模拟器

在安卓模拟器安装完成并配置好后,启动模拟器。根据提示完成初始设置,包括登录Google账户、设置语言和时间等。初次启动模拟器可能需要一些时间,请耐心等待。

2、安装和运行应用

在模拟器中,可以通过内置的Google Play商店安装应用和游戏。也可以通过拖放APK文件的方式直接安装应用。安装完成后,点击应用图标即可运行。对于需要调试的应用,可以通过ADB(Android Debug Bridge)连接模拟器进行调试。

六、常见问题及解决方法

1、模拟器卡顿或性能低下

如果在使用过程中遇到模拟器卡顿或性能低下的问题,可以尝试以下方法解决:增加虚拟机的系统资源分配、启用硬件加速、关闭不必要的后台进程、调整模拟器的图形设置。

2、应用兼容性问题

有些应用可能在模拟器中无法正常运行,这可能是由于兼容性问题造成的。可以尝试更换不同版本的模拟器,或者在模拟器的设置中调整兼容性选项。如果问题依然存在,可以通过联系应用开发者或模拟器官方客服寻求帮助。

七、进阶技巧

1、使用ADB调试

对于开发者来说,使用ADB调试是非常重要的技能。通过ADB,可以在模拟器中安装、卸载应用,查看日志,执行命令等。要使用ADB调试,首先需要在模拟器中启用开发者选项和USB调试,然后在虚拟机中安装ADB工具包,并连接模拟器进行调试。

2、创建快照和恢复点

在虚拟机管理软件中,可以创建快照和恢复点,以便在需要时快速恢复系统状态。这对于测试和调试工作非常有帮助。创建快照的方法因虚拟机管理软件不同而有所差异,一般在虚拟机的管理界面中可以找到相关选项。

八、推荐项目管理系统

在项目管理和团队协作中,使用专业的项目管理系统可以极大提高效率和沟通效果。研发项目管理系统PingCode是一款专为软件研发团队设计的项目管理工具,提供了丰富的研发管理功能,如需求管理、缺陷跟踪、迭代管理等。通用项目协作软件Worktile则适用于各类团队和项目,提供了任务管理、文档协作、日程安排等功能,帮助团队高效协作。

通过以上步骤,你可以在虚拟机上成功运行安卓模拟器,并且通过优化配置和解决兼容性问题,确保模拟器的流畅运行。希望这些方法和技巧能帮助你在虚拟机中更好地使用安卓模拟器,提高工作和娱乐的效率。

相关问答FAQs:

1. 安卓模拟器是什么?它有什么用途?

安卓模拟器是一种软件,它可以模拟安卓操作系统在计算机上的运行环境。它的主要用途是让用户能够在计算机上运行安卓应用程序,而无需实际的安卓设备。

2. 我应该如何选择合适的安卓模拟器?

选择合适的安卓模拟器取决于您的需求。一些模拟器适用于开发人员,提供更多的调试和测试功能,而另一些模拟器适合普通用户,提供更简单易用的界面。您还可以考虑模拟器的性能、兼容性和安全性等因素。

3. 如何在安卓模拟器上安装虚拟机?

在安卓模拟器上安装虚拟机需要以下步骤:

  1. 首先,下载和安装合适的安卓模拟器软件。
  2. 其次,启动安卓模拟器并完成初始化设置。
  3. 然后,打开模拟器的应用商店或下载虚拟机的安装文件。
  4. 最后,按照虚拟机安装程序的指示进行安装,并在安卓模拟器上运行虚拟机。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/2813749

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部